I replaced them for energy suspension polyurethane bushings, but i reccommend keeping the stock ones for a more comfortable and positive shift, plus mine is making a noise now so i regret replacing them in the first place.

if you get shift linkage bushings you absolutely have to get black ones...red ones will squeak. And I like ES bushings quite a bit.
